What are the CVSS 3 ratings

Table 14: Qualitative severity rating scale

Rating CVSS Score
Low 0.1 – 3.9
Medium 4.0 – 6.9
High 7.0 – 8.9
Critical 9.0 – 10.0

What does a CVSS score of 10 mean

CVSS scores are calculated using a formula consisting of vulnerability-based metrics. A CVSS score is derived from scores in these three groups: Base, Temporal and Environmental. Scores range from zero to 10, with zero representing the least severe and 10 representing the most severe.

What are CVSS 2.0 scores

NVD Vulnerability Severity Ratings

CVSS v2.0 Ratings CVSS v3.0 Ratings
Severity Base Score Range Base Score Range
Low 0.0-3.9 0.1-3.9
Medium 4.0-6.9 4.0-6.9
High 7.0-10.0 7.0-8.9

Does PCI use CVSS 2 or 3

What is a"pass" or "fail" PCI audit result based on An ASV bases the audit result on the Common Vulnerability Scoring System (CVSS), Version 2, score that is calculated for every vulnerability. Scores range from 0 to 10.0, with 4.0 or higher indicating failure to comply with PCI standards.

What is CVE vs CVSS score

The CVE represents a summarized vulnerability, while the Common Vulnerability Scoring System (CVSS) assesses the vulnerability in detail and scores it, based on several factors.

Which are scores that go into a CVSS 3.1 score

CVSS is composed of three metric groups: Base, Temporal, and Environmental. The Base Score reflects the severity of a vulnerability according to its intrinsic characteristics which are constant over time and assumes the reasonable worst case impact across different deployed environments.

What is 9.8 CVSS score

CVSS score 9.8 vs 10.0

At the same time, the highest possible score when the scope is unchanged is 9.8. This is when all impact scores are high and all exploitability metrics are most severe. This is also the only way to get a CVSS base score of 9.8.

When was CVSS v3 0 released

June 2015

To address some of these criticisms, development of CVSS version 3 was started in 2012. The final specification was named CVSS v3. 0 and released in June 2015. In addition to a Specification Document, a User Guide and Examples document were also released.

What is PCI Level 1 to 4

Level 1: Merchants that process over 6 million card transactions annually. Level 2: Merchants that process 1 to 6 million transactions annually. Level 3: Merchants that process 20,000 to 1 million transactions annually. Level 4: Merchants that process fewer than 20,000 transactions annually.

What is requirement 4 PCI

PCI DSS Requirement 4: Encrypt transmission of cardholder data across open, public networks. Similar to requirement 3, in this requirement, you must secure the card data when it is transmitted over an open or public network (e.g. Internet, 802.11, Bluetooth, GSM, CDMA, GPRS).
